February 2011. Norfolk NMP.
The earthworks and former earthworks of a series of banks and boundaries are visible on aerial photographs on Snarehill Heath (S1-S2). While it is possible that these boundaries merely relate to post medieval woodland and heathland boundaries, it is also feasible that they relate to medieval warren boundaries, as the Snarehill Heath was the location of a medieval rabbit warren (NHER 54066).
S. Horlock (NMP), 18 February 2011.
